1. A nurse is teaching a client who has chronic kidney disease about dietary needs. Which of the following foods should the nurse identify as being the lowest in phosphorus?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: Apples are low in phosphorus, making them a suitable option for clients with chronic kidney disease.

2. A nurse is teaching a client about strategies to prevent constipation. Which of the following statements by the client indicates an understanding of the teaching?

Correct answer: C

Rationale: Eating foods high in fiber increases stool bulk and promotes easier elimination, thus preventing constipation.

3. A nurse is caring for a client who is taking antibiotics and develops diarrhea. Which of the following foods should the nurse recommend to include in the client’s diet?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: Yogurt contains probiotics that can help restore normal gut flora and reduce antibiotic-associated diarrhea.

4. A nurse is caring for a 30-month-old toddler and is preparing a nutritional snack. Which of the following foods is appropriate for the nurse to offer the toddler?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: Cheese is a safe and nutritious option for toddlers, providing calcium and protein without choking hazards.

5. A nurse is reviewing blood glucose values for a client who is at risk for Diabetes Mellitus. Which of the following findings should the nurse report to the provider?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: A 2-hour glucose tolerance test level of 150 mg/dL is above the normal range and should be reported to the provider as it indicates impaired glucose tolerance.
